The further IE and other outdated browsers are in the rearview, the easier it will be to bring the latest CSS developments to production websites. Compare that with the nearly 2% it captured a year earlier.Ĭhart courtesy of StatCounter Global Stats According to StatCounter Global Stats, usage of IE was down to a measly 1.05% of the market as of October 2020. That’s due to the dwindling number of users for legacy browsers such as Internet Explorer. And while fallbacks are never a bad idea, they may not need to be as drastic. CSS Grid layouts, for example, are a much safer bet than they were a few years ago. In practice, this means web designers can adopt new techniques with confidence. As modern versions of Chrome, Edge, Firefox and Safari are released, support for newer CSS standards and specs grow. The language benefitted from the continued steady evolution of web browsers. All you need to do is to copy that CSS code and paste it into an OutSystems application’s stylesheet. It will scan all the style properties of the file and generate the CSS accordingly. Once installed, the plugin needs to run with the design kit file opened. These plugins can be found in the marketplaces of their respective communities, but you can find all the information on the OutSystems UI website. Plugins will work as extensions to the design tools (figma, sketch and adobe Xd) and once you run them with the design kit file open, they will read all the CSS properties. We are releasing the OutSystems UI kit file for adobe XD (This is NEW!), so it’s now possible to use the full library of design patterns and screen templates on this adobe design tool.
